Dipeptide Boc-Ser(Bzl)-Gly-OH: A solution of Boc-Ser(Bzl)-OH (23.6 g) and N-hydroxysuccinimide (9.8 g) in EtOAc (400 mL) was cooled to 0° C. A solution of DCC (71.54 g) in EtOAc (100 mL) was added to the cooled solution. The mixture was stirred at 0° C. for 4 h and then filtered. The collected solid was washed with EtOAc. The filtrate was cooled to 0° C. HCl.H-Gly-OCH3 (10.67 g) and DIEA (42 mL) was added to the cooled solution. The mixture was stirred for 18 h while the temperature of the mixture gradually came to room temperature. The mixture was filtered. The filtrate was concentrated to ca 400 mL, washed serially with H2O, 5% aqueous NaHCO3, 1N HCl and H2O, dried (Na2SO4 /MgSO4), and concentrated to dryness. The residual oil was dissolved in Et2O (100 mL). A flocculent precipitate developed which was removed by filtration. The filtrate was concentrated to dryness and dried under reduced pressure to give Boc-Ser(Bzl)-Gly-OCH3 as a colorless oil (28.7 g). A solution of the latter compound (28.0 g) in dioxane (140 mL) and H2O (60 mL) was cooled to 0° C. A solution of NaOH (4.0 g) in H2O (80 mL) was added dropwise to preceding solution. The mixture was stirred at 0° C. during the addition and for 15 min thereafter. The mixture was diluted with H2O and washed with Et 2 O. The aqueous phase was separated and shaken with EtOAc. Solid citric acid was added to mixture (pH=3-4). The aqueous layer was separated from the EtOAc and extracted with fresh EtOAc. The combined organic extracts were washed with H2O, dried (Na2SO4) and concentrated. The glassy residue was dried under high vacuum to give the dipeptide Boc-Ser(Bzl)-Gly-OH (27.22 g).
